The two-way table below shows the number of students in a survey of 200, categorized by grade level and whether they play a school sport. | Play Sport | No Sport | Total Grade 11 | 30 | 50 | 80 Grade 12 | 60 | 60 | 120 Total | 90 | 110 | 200 A student from this survey is selected at random and is known to be in Grade 12. What is the probability, expressed as a fraction in simplest form, that this student plays a sport?
